Determinants of elasticity of demand10/4/20108CHARU NAGPAL
1. Time elementDemand is inelastic in short period but elastic in long period. It is because in the long run, a consumer can change his habits more conveniently than in the short run10/4/20109CHARU NAGPAL
2. Nature of CommodityNecessaries like salt, match box etc… have inelastic demand Luxuries like ac, furniture, fashionable clothes, have highly elastic demand10/4/201010CHARU NAGPAL
3. Availability of SubstitutesDemand for those commodities which have substitutes are relatively more elastic because when the price of commodity falls in relation to its substitute, the consumer will go in for it and so its demand will increase10/4/201011CHARU NAGPAL
